反应信息

  • 作为产物:
    描述:
    (2E,4E)-ethyl 5-nitropenta-2,4-dienoate噻吩-2-甲酸亚铜(I)(R)-(S)-josiphos氢气 作用下, 以 甲醇乙醚 为溶剂, -10.0 ℃ 、1.38 MPa 条件下, 反应 48.0h, 生成 3-methylpiperidin-2-one
    参考文献:
    名称:
    有机金属试剂与线性和共轭硝基烯烃的对映和区域选择性共轭加成反应
    摘要:
    据报道,铜催化将三烷基铝和二烷基锌试剂共轭加成到共轭硝基烯烃(硝基二烯和亚硝基炔衍生物)中。反向的Josiphos配体L7可实现对映体选择性高的选择性1,4或1,6加成。
    DOI:
    10.1002/chem.201300538

  • Enantioselective and Regiodivergent Copper-Catalyzed Conjugate Addition of Trialkylaluminium Reagents to Extended Nitro-Michael Acceptors
    作者:Matthieu Tissot、Daniel Müller、Sébastien Belot、Alexandre Alexakis
    DOI:10.1021/ol100849j
    日期:2010.6.18
    first highly enantioselective and regiodivergent conjugate addition of trialkylaluminium reagents to nitrodienes and nitroenynes is described. By a design of the substrate and a fine-tuning of the reaction conditions, it is possible to selectively form the 1,4- or 1,6-adduct. The same combination of catalyst, copper source, and a ferrocene-based phosphine ligand afforded enantioselectivities up to 95%
    描述了三烷基铝试剂向硝基二烯和硝基炔的第一次高对映选择性和区域发散性共轭加成。通过底物的设计和反应条件的微调,可以选择性地形成1,4-或1,6-加合物。催化剂,铜源和二茂铁基膦配体的相同组合分别提供高达95%和91%的对映选择性。
